Abstract

rain head (10) comprises a lower body (12), a screen (16) and an upper body (12). The screen (16) includes a frame (32) having a trough or recess (34). Lower parts of the sidewalls of the upper body 14 can fit into the trough or recess (34) to enable the upper body (14) to be removably mounted to the rain head (10). The screen (16) also includes a peripheral flange (38) and a downwardly extending lip (46) that enable the screen (16) to be removably mounted to the upper part of the lower body (12). At least some water splashing off the screen during a rain event comes into contact with the upper body and is re-directed to flow into the lower body (12) and out through the outlet (18) of the lower body (12) to a rainwater collection tank. Claims (22)

1. A rain head comprising a lower body for fitting to a pe, the lower body having a passage therethrough so that rainwater can flow through the lower body and into the downpipe, and an upper body, the upper body having an opening in a bottom part, a top opening through which an upper downpipe can extend, the upper body having at least one downwardly ing sidewall, wherein at least some water splashing in the rain head contacts the downwardly extending sidewall(s) of the upper body and the water is directed s the e in the lower body of the rain head.
2. A rain head as claimed in claim 1 wherein the upper body ses a removable upper body.
3. A rain head as claimed in claim 1 or claim 2 wherein the rain head includes a screen, the screen sing a mesh or a strainer having apertures therein, the mesh or strainer preventing flow of leaves and debris of size larger than an opening size of the apertures from flowing through the mesh or strainer, the mesh or strainer surrounded by a frame.
4. A rain head as claimed in claim 3 wherein the frame has a peripheral flange that can rest on an upper edge of the lower body.
5. A rain head as claimed in claim 4 wherein the peripheral flange has a downwardly extending outer lip ing at least part way around the peripheral flange, the downwardly extending outer lip overlying an upper portion of one or more sidewalls of the lower body when the screen is mounted to the lower body.
6. A rain head as claimed in claim 5 wherein the peripheral flange has a downwardly extending wall or projection extending from an inner part of the flange, the downwardly extending wall or projection being spaced from the downwardly ing outer lip, wherein a space between the downwardly ing outer lip and the downwardly extending wall or projection extending from the inner part of flange can receive the upper edge of the lower body or can be fitted over the upper edge of the lower body of the rain head.
7. A rain head as claimed in any one of claims 3 to 6 wherein the screen is provided with a trough or recess or a slot.
8. A rain head as claimed in claim 7 wherein the trough or recess or slot is formed in the frame and extends around and encircles the mesh or screen, the trough or recess or slot adapted to receive a lower edge of the upper body to enable the upper body to be bly mounted to the screen.
9. A rain head as claimed in claim 7 or claim 8 wherein the trough or recess has openings in a lower part thereof to enable water to flow or drain therethrough
10. A rain head as claimed in any one of claims 7 to 9 wherein the trough or recess is defined by a plurality of spaced U-shaped projections and the space between adjacent U-shaped tions allows water to drain therethrough.
11. A rain head as claimed in claim 3 wherein the screen has a wall or edge that is spaced from a wall of the lower body such that a space is defined between the wall or edge of the screen and the wall of the lower body and the upper body has a lower edge that is positioned in the space when the upper body is fitted to the rain head.
12. A rain head as claimed in claim 11 wherein the lower body has one or more projections that support the screen when the screen is fitted to the lower body.
13. A rain head as claimed in any one of the preceding claims wherein the upper body has a rear side wall that is shorter than a front side wall, with side sidewalls of the upper body having lower edges that slope downwardly from the rear side wall towards the front side wall.
14. A rain head as claimed in any one of claims 3 to 13 wherein the screen is removably mounted to the lower body and the upper body is bly mounted in the rain head.
